      Fluid Mechanics

      An Introduction to the Theory of Fluid Flows

      • 840 pages
      • 30 hours of reading

      The book offers a comprehensive introduction to fluid mechanics, tailored for engineering and natural science students. It focuses on the Conventional Navier-Stokes Equations, providing detailed analytical treatments of fluid flows. Readers will gain a solid understanding of the physics and mathematics underlying fundamental flow problems. Additionally, the text introduces numerical methods and experimental techniques relevant to fluid mechanics, equipping students with practical knowledge for real-world applications.
